Wide load is not a big deal once you know the red tape. I've been 'wide-loading' it for the past 5 years.

I think most states are anything over 8'6" (102") . . . Even my trailer is over the 'limit', 'cuz it measures about 108" wide.

102 is the Fed standard same is 13'6" on height. Many states have no issue with 9'6" and others is 10'0", but others have issue. That's why i mentioned "depends on the state"
